diff options
Diffstat (limited to 'asn1/ulp/ULP.asn')
-rw-r--r-- | asn1/ulp/ULP.asn | 85 |
1 files changed, 45 insertions, 40 deletions
diff --git a/asn1/ulp/ULP.asn b/asn1/ulp/ULP.asn index 00c52e6c6b..2482d7a0eb 100644 --- a/asn1/ulp/ULP.asn +++ b/asn1/ulp/ULP.asn @@ -1,67 +1,72 @@ --- UPL.asn +-- ULP.asn -- -- Taken from OMA UserPlane Location Protocol --- http://www.openmobilealliance.org/technical/release_program/docs/SUPL/V2_0-20080627-C/OMA-TS-ULP-V2_0-20080627-C.pdf +-- http://member.openmobilealliance.org/ftp/Public_documents/LOC/Permanent_documents/OMA-TS-ULP-V2_0-20100816-C.zip -- --- 8.1 Common Part +-- 11.1 Common Part -- ULP DEFINITIONS AUTOMATIC TAGS ::= BEGIN + IMPORTS -Version, SessionID + Version, SessionID FROM ULP-Components -SUPLINIT + SUPLINIT FROM SUPL-INIT -SUPLSTART + SUPLSTART FROM SUPL-START -SUPLRESPONSE + SUPLRESPONSE FROM SUPL-RESPONSE -SUPLPOSINIT + SUPLPOSINIT FROM SUPL-POS-INIT -SUPLPOS + SUPLPOS FROM SUPL-POS -SUPLEND + SUPLEND FROM SUPL-END -SUPLAUTHREQ + SUPLAUTHREQ FROM SUPL-AUTH-REQ -SUPLAUTHRESP + SUPLAUTHRESP FROM SUPL-AUTH-RESP -Ver2-SUPLTRIGGEREDSTART + Ver2-SUPLTRIGGEREDSTART FROM SUPL-TRIGGERED-START -Ver2-SUPLTRIGGEREDRESPONSE + Ver2-SUPLTRIGGEREDRESPONSE FROM SUPL-TRIGGERED-RESPONSE -Ver2-SUPLREPORT + Ver2-SUPLREPORT FROM SUPL-REPORT -Ver2-SUPLTRIGGEREDSTOP + Ver2-SUPLTRIGGEREDSTOP FROM SUPL-TRIGGERED-STOP -Ver2-SUPLSETINIT + Ver2-SUPLSETINIT FROM SUPL-SET-INIT -Ver2-SUPLNOTIFY + Ver2-SUPLNOTIFY FROM SUPL-NOTIFY -Ver2-SUPLNOTIFYRESPONSE + Ver2-SUPLNOTIFYRESPONSE FROM SUPL-NOTIFY-RESPONSE; + -- general ULP PDU layout;-- ULP-PDU ::= SEQUENCE { -length INTEGER(0..65535), -version Version, -sessionID SessionID, -message UlpMessage} + length INTEGER(0..65535), + version Version, + sessionID SessionID, + message UlpMessage} + UlpMessage ::= CHOICE { -msSUPLINIT SUPLINIT, -msSUPLSTART SUPLSTART, -msSUPLRESPONSE SUPLRESPONSE, -msSUPLPOSINIT SUPLPOSINIT, -msSUPLPOS SUPLPOS, -msSUPLEND SUPLEND, -msSUPLAUTHREQ SUPLAUTHREQ, -msSUPLAUTHRESP SUPLAUTHRESP, -..., -msSUPLTRIGGEREDSTART Ver2-SUPLTRIGGEREDSTART, -msSUPLTRIGGEREDRESPONSE Ver2-SUPLTRIGGEREDRESPONSE, -msSUPLTRIGGEREDSTOP Ver2-SUPLTRIGGEREDSTOP, -msSUPLNOTIFY Ver2-SUPLNOTIFY, -msSUPLNOTIFYRESPONSE Ver2-SUPLNOTIFYRESPONSE, -msSUPLSETINIT Ver2-SUPLSETINIT, -msSUPLREPORT Ver2-SUPLREPORT} -END
\ No newline at end of file + msSUPLINIT SUPLINIT, + msSUPLSTART SUPLSTART, + msSUPLRESPONSE SUPLRESPONSE, + msSUPLPOSINIT SUPLPOSINIT, + msSUPLPOS SUPLPOS, + msSUPLEND SUPLEND, + msSUPLAUTHREQ SUPLAUTHREQ, + msSUPLAUTHRESP SUPLAUTHRESP, + ..., + msSUPLTRIGGEREDSTART Ver2-SUPLTRIGGEREDSTART, + msSUPLTRIGGEREDRESPONSE Ver2-SUPLTRIGGEREDRESPONSE, + msSUPLTRIGGEREDSTOP Ver2-SUPLTRIGGEREDSTOP, + msSUPLNOTIFY Ver2-SUPLNOTIFY, + msSUPLNOTIFYRESPONSE Ver2-SUPLNOTIFYRESPONSE, + msSUPLSETINIT Ver2-SUPLSETINIT, +msSUPLREPORT Ver2-SUPLREPORT} + +END + |